Soldier Murdered In Rock River, Clarendon

The Jamaica Defence Force is this morning mourning the loss of one of their colleague.

31-year-old soldier Lance Corporal Michael Fraser was shot dead near his home in Rock River, Clarendon around 8:30 last night.

It is reported that he was shot in the head.

Investigators say it appears that the soldier may have been attacked by two men.

Police investigators have launched a high-level investigation into the murder.
